Abstract

The tourist and recreational system (TRS) of the Krasnodar region has been actively developing for the last 16 years. The exception is the pandemic year, when tourism enterprises around the world suffered enormous losses. The article analyzes the current state of development of the region’s TRS, which allowed us to conclude that its stable development is quite rapid, as evidenced by the main indicators: the dynamics of tourist flow growth for the period from 2006 to 2021 - an increase of 3.5 times, and in some years even more (from 4.8 to 16.8 million people, in 2019 to 17.5 million people); the number of collective accommodation facilities (CAF) has increased significantly - by 4.6 times (from 1183 units in 2006 to 5404 units in 2021); the number of rooms from 2006 (85.6 thousand rooms) to 2020 (190.5 thousand rooms) increased by 2.3 times; the growth of one-time capacity was 2.24 times from 211.2 thousand seats in 2006 up to 473.4 thousand places in 2021; the number of persons placed in CAF of the region increased 3.8 times from 2634.2 thousand people in 2006 to 9980.5 thousand people in 2021; the income of CAF from 2006 to 2021 increased 6.7 times (from 21267 million rubles in 2006 to 142076.6 million rubles in 2021). The state and region support measures helped to achieve stable growth. Also, the development of tourism is promoted at first glance by negative modern economic and geopolitical conditions. In addition, the TRS of the Krasnodar Krai is currently recognized as the best in the country, which also contributes to its development. Leading positions (first place in the National Tourism Rating) were achieved thanks to many factors: natural and climatic, historical and cultural, ethnographic, administrative, economic and political, etc. However, despite all this, there are a number of problems in the development of TRS that require immediate solutions. One of the main problems of the TRS of the Krasnodar region is that it develops extremely heterogeneously. The territorial asymmetry of the development of TRS during the considered 16 years (from 2006 to 2021) remains in favor of the Azov-Black Sea coast of the region and the regional capital - Krasnodar, which are the largest points of attraction of the tourist flow, in view of their possession of enormous tourist resources and consumer orientation. The solution to this problem is moving towards resolution very slowly. Only a small part of the municipalities of the region have improved their indicators regarding the infrastructure complex of the territory for the creation, promotion and sale of tourist products over the considered 16 years. Most municipalities still have a low level of provision with the necessary infrastructure.
